The Importance of Restoration

Antique restoration plays a crucial role in preserving cultural heritage and extending the lifespan of timeless works of art. By restoring antiques, we not only maintain their physical integrity but also ensure their continued appreciation and enjoyment by future generations.

Understanding the Restoration Process

Antique restoration is a delicate and specialized process that requires a deep understanding of the materials and techniques used by past masters. Restorers meticulously analyze the artwork, identify areas of damage, and develop customized restoration plans to restore the piece to its original glory.

Methods of Restoration

Antique restoration employs various methods, including:

  • Cleaning and surface restoration to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ants
  • Structural repairs to stabilize damaged areas and restore integrity
  • Refinishing and repainting to restore the original appearance

The Role of Conservators

Art conservators play a pivotal role in antique restoration. They possess advanced training and expertise in preserving and safeguarding cultural artifacts. Their involvement ensures that restoration techniques are ethical, reversible, and respectful of the original artwork.

Advancements in Restoration Techniques

Technological advancements have significantly aided antique restoration in recent years. Non-invasive imaging techniques, such as X-rays and infrared reflectography, provide deeper insights into the artwork’s condition. Laser technology allows for precise cleaning and removal of harmful stains without compromising the original surface. These advancements continue to enhance the accuracy and effectiveness of antique restoration.
